Gr 8 Up—This collection of short stories captures the liminal spaces inhabited by Victor Reyes Jr., a Mexican American/Chicano Fresno teenager who is caught between the dangerous allure of the streets and his creative aspirations. At times, the choice between becoming another "cholo" stereotype and going down another path eludes Victor. The gravity of the streets often proves to be beyond Victor's control. "I died when I was fourteen years old." Victor Reyes was shot in a gunfight and declared dead (though only for two minutes), and his mother thinks he's a lost cause for hanging out with cholos. Except that he's not a gangbanger at all. Victor doesn't know what he wants to be, but he knows he isn't a cholo and doesn't want to be treated like he's going nowhere.
